Given: y = 3 x − 4 . For what value of x does y equal zero?

Value of x would be equal to 4/3

0 = 3x - 4
+4 +4

4 = 3 x {Divide each side by 3}

Which gives you the value of x = 4/3 or 1.33 if rounded
